The Healthy Climate Monitor (HCM) needs a data connection to the internet to send measurements and photos to the server, so they are available on your app.
There are 3 connection options:
4G network (in device by default)
Network cable (in DATA IN port on power supply)
WiFi network (to be set up via phone/email)
If there is no, or poor 4G, or wifi in the barn, you can connect the HCM to an external network via an additional network cable. Connect the network cable to the DATA IN port of the PoE power supply (in the orange housing).
This external network can be the stable's internet, or from an additional 4G router with internet connection that you can place outside the stable.
The connection priority of the HCM is as follows:
Network cable
WiFi network
4G network
4G network
So as soon as you plug a network cable into the DATA IN port of the HCM's PoE power supply, or connect the HCM to a WiFi network, the internal 4G connection is disabled.
If you want to connect the HCM to the 4G network, but the range in the barn is insufficient, you can purchase an external 4G modem from us, as shown below.

It is connected as follows:

Aanzetten Healthy Climate Monitor
1. Hang the Healthy Climate Monitor + any external sensors at the desired location in the barn
2. HCM power cable unroll and connect to the HCM
3. 230V Power plug connect to a power socket
4. 4G Extender Power button press 5 sec = ON
(The HCM will now connect via WiFi or Ethernet with the 4G Extender)
5. Check the data connection in the HCM app.
NB: If you have an HCM 2.0 (where you cannot configure the WiFi network yourself) and want to use a WiFi network, please contact us after the router is paired with an HCM and when both devices are on. Then we can then configure the HCM's WiFi network remotely.
